How To Apply For A Job
|
Have you ever wondered how to apply for a job? It may be that you are trying to get your very first job, or that you aren't sure how to go about applying in an industry you are not familiar with. Since companies do often have their own set of rules regarding the application process, you may be nervous about whether you are doing the right thing. Below, you will find out how to apply for a job so that no matter where you are trying to get work, you will make the best impression.
1. If there is a job advertisement, read it again. Many employers tell you exactly what they want you to do in their ad. They may want you to come in and fill out an application, or they may want a resume that is submitted online through email. Follow their instructions to the letter, otherwise they may think you cannot follow simple instructions.
2. Prepare your resume and cover letter. In some circumstances you will need a resume and cover letter, in others you will not. Even if you aren't certain about whether the employer where you are applying wants a resume, go ahead and write it. If you find out that an application is all that is necessary, you will have great experience in writing a resume, and it will help you sort out your thoughts so that the interview goes smoothly.
3. Call the company and ask. If the job ad contained no information about the applications process, it is perfectly fine to call and ask. Give your name and tell them you are inquiring about the position that is available. Then ask how to go about applying, and who your resume (if one is required) should be directed to.
4. Apply in person. If you do find that an application is all that is needed, visit the employer during a time of day that they aren't likely to be as busy, such as mid-morning. If possible, speak to the hiring manager personally and give them your application. This will give you a chance to demonstrate your enthusiasm for the job, and allow the hiring manager to put a face with a name.
5. Follow up. Whether you submitted a simple application or a cover letter and resume, it is essential that you follow up so that the prospective employer can see you are really interested in the job. If you submitted an application, call or go by two to three days later to check on the status. If you submitted a resume and cover letter by mail or online, send a follow up letter about a week later. You might also consider calling to confirm they did receive your resume.
No matter how you go about applying for employment, always present a positive attitude and enthusiasm for the position. Employers like to see that an individual is excited about the job. Be sure to include any skills or accomplishments that will lend to your ability to perform the job better than other candidates.
Now that you know how to apply for a job, you don't have to be afraid that you will make the wrong move. Be confident, display your abilities, and you will come out a winner.
